Description

2-Chloro-3,4-Dimethoxybenzonitrile is a versatile aromatic nitrile derivative characterized by its chloro and dimethoxy substituents. This compound serves as a crucial high-purity building block and key intermediate in advanced organic synthesis, enabling the development of complex molecules. It is primarily utilized by research institutions and industrial manufacturers in the pharmaceutical and agrochemical sectors for the development of active ingredients and fine chemicals.

Basic Information

Item Detail
Product Name 2-Chloro-3,4-Dimethoxybenzonitrile
CAS No. 119413-61-5
Molecular Formula C9H8ClNO2
Molecular Weight 197.62 g/mol
Synonyms 2-Chloro-3,4-dimethoxybenzonitrile; 3,4-Dimethoxy-2-chlorobenzonitrile; Benzonitrile, 2-chloro-3,4-dimethoxy-; 2-Chloro-3,4-dimethoxybenzene carbonitrile; 2-Chloro-3,4-dimethoxy-phenyl cyanide

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at controlled room temperature (15-25°C). Keep away from heat, sparks, and open flame. The compound is light-sensitive and should be handled accordingly to maintain stability.
